谈谈如何应对DDoS攻击? DDoS(Distributed Denial of Service)攻击是一种通过向目标服务器发送大量请求来耗尽其网络资源和带宽的攻击方式。这种攻击能够导致网站瘫痪,重要信息泄露,业务中断等问题。在这篇文章中,我们将探讨如何应对DDoS攻击。 1. 实施防御策略 为了保护您的系统免受DDoS攻击,您应该实施以下防御策略: - 强化网络安全设置,包括网络拓扑、端口访问控制、防火墙、入侵检测系统(IDS)、入侵防御系统(IPS)、VPN和数据包过滤等; - 部署DDoS防御软件和硬件,如负载均衡器、DDoS清洗设备、防火墙等; - 定期进行漏洞扫描和系统更新; - 配置应急响应计划并进行定期的网络安全培训。 2. 掌握DDoS攻击类型 DDoS攻击类型包括以下: - UDP Flood:通过向UDP(用户数据报协议)端口发送高速大量的数据包来占用网络带宽; - ICMP Flood:向目标服务器发送大量ICMP(Internet控制消息协议)数据包,使其无法响应合法请求; - SYN Flood:发送大量SYN(同步)请求,占用服务器资源; - HTTP Flood:模拟合法的HTTP请求,并发送到服务器上,导致服务器无法处理合法请求; - Slowloris Attack:发送大量慢速请求,使服务器被无效连接请求堵塞。 3. 采用流量清洗技术 流量清洗技术是一种有效的DDoS防御手段,它可对入站流量进行过滤和分析,以便及时检测和阻止恶意流量。流量清洗技术通常采用以下两种方法: - 软件清洗:利用流量清洗软件来过滤恶意流量; - 硬件清洗:部署DDoS清洗设备来过滤流量。 4. 利用云端防御服务 云端防御服务是一种DDoS防御的有效方式,它通过将您的服务部署在云端,以便从云端过滤所有入站流量,从而保护您的服务免受DDoS攻击。云端防御服务可对流量进行实时分析和过滤,以确保恶意流量不会影响合法请求。 总结 DDoS攻击是目前互联网上最常见的网络攻击之一。为了有效防御DDoS攻击,我们应该加强网络安全设置并采用流量清洗技术和云端防御服务,以保护我们的网络免受攻击。最重要的是,我们需要时刻关注最新的网络安全威胁和防御技术,以保持我们的系统在最高的安全状态。